Saxby Hill is a climb in the region Lincolnshire. It is 0.8 km long and bridges 74 m of vertical ascent with an average gradient of 9%, resulting in a difficulty score of 72. The top of the ascent is located at 95 m above sea level. Climbfinder users shared 0 reviews of this climb and uploaded 0 photos.
